Transaction 1b8625ec15c30e7a673e32ae86a7c95213eba2860d7768c240c42432d996a27d
1 Input
1 Output
-
1b8625ec15c30e7a673e32ae86a7c95213eba2860d7768c240c42432d996a27d:0
- value
- 192671559
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e2e17391e7d7750e724111b1b65af3521d8eea1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12Hyg8EPN5BVYPmSvR4FJGjkbaUfjMYCjf